Output aadfa98071720c53e81c8e2f065c5118779cfe32fc251d568f052a18ed8b9327:0

value
1421967
script pubkey
OP_0 OP_PUSHBYTES_20 95ca8fc7da741582411e2fc05b4ba22754629f9c
address
bc1qjh9gl376ws2cysg79lq9kjazya2x98uuxnufqt
transaction
aadfa98071720c53e81c8e2f065c5118779cfe32fc251d568f052a18ed8b9327
confirmations
117310
spent
true